◍ Types of self defense.
Answer: Individual self defense: The act of defending oneself or other
persons by using force. Unit self defense: The act of defending a particular
unit of U.S. forces, and other U.S. forces in the vicinity, against a hostile act
or hostile intent. National self defense: national self defense is the act of
defending the United States, U.S. forces, and/ or in certain circumstances,
U.S. citizens and their property, U.S. commercial assets, or other non
designated U.S. forces, foreign nationals and their property, from a hostile
act or hostile intent.

◍ Gas and radiation monitoring equipment.
Answer: All boarding team members shall carry the coast guard standard 4
gas analyzer during any boarding in which they may enter enclosed spaces.
If entry is necessary to spaces where specific atmospheric hazards may exist
- ammonia, hydrogen sulfide, carbon monoxide, or flammable gases —
there must be a competent person available to the boarding team with the
necessary gas detection equipment to certify that the spaces are safe for
entry as per confined space entry guidance. Boarding teams shall carry the
coast guard standard personnel radiation detector and shall have more
sophisticated radiation location and characterization equipment available
